Rarely Available – Soho Offices to Rent 1,200 sq ft

This office is located just north of Soho Square and presents a unique opportunity to acquire a large space suitable for 20 or so people on flexible terms, with its own amenities. The space has been competitively priced at £8,500 per month + VAT. which includes pretty much everything you’ll need like furniture, internet, rent, […]